First AH1N1 update, detailing steps and precautions I've taken towards making sure this NYC trip remains healthy and virus-free.
Got flu vaccination shot at the MAA in Kelana Jaya today, only for frontliners , supplied by Novartis. Conditions were at least 48hours before the next flight, and not allergic to egg- or egg byproducts. Jab on the shoulder, and was advised that due to the reaction by the body itself, may vary from slight mild temperature rise to am actual fever itself, as the body scrambles to produce antibody to combat the flu virus. The vaccine itself is of course a modified flu-virus, designed to encourage production of antibody within the injected person. That way, it provides self-immunity, but only definite immunity towards the flu-virus on which that vaccine is produced from. This is not a vaccine for the AH1N1, I'll still be susceptible to the virus and flu itself if I dont maintain a clean hygienic practices like washing hands before/after eating, and most importantly. not to poke your fingers into your nose/eyes/mouth that would allow transmittal of drop infection of the virus.(Carrier sneezes, or wipes nose, fluid from sneeze or runny nose gets onto your fingers, and you poke it into those cavities where fluid transfer is possible).
